A respected cardiology practice in Dallas, TX is seeking a part-time Cardiac Sonographer to support its growing patient volume. This position offers a flexible schedule, access to modern imaging equipment, and the opportunity to work with a skilled cardiovascular team in a patient-focused environment.
Key Responsibilities
- Perform transthoracic echocardiograms and assist with stress and transesophageal echocardiography as needed
- Evaluate cardiac structure and function using ultrasound imaging
- Prepare patients and explain procedures with clarity and compassion
- Collaborate with cardiologists for accurate image interpretation
- Ensure proper operation and maintenance of ultrasound equipment
- Document findings and maintain image records in the PACS system

Job Requirements
- Certification as RDCS (via ARDMS) or RCS (via CCI)
- Minimum 2 years of recent experience in cardiac sonography
- Current BLS certification
- Completion of the SPI exam (if ARDMS certified)
- Texas medical imaging license or eligibility to obtain
- Excellent patient care skills and attention to detail
